## Ownership: Log Compaction

Log compaction in the Tidemark message queue runs as a background task on each broker and reclaims segments whose keys have newer values. If support sees disk alerts on a broker, check the compaction lag metric before escalating; lag above two hours usually means a stuck segment. Do not delete segment files manually. Escalations about compaction behavior, tuning, or stuck segments should go to the component owner listed below.

named custodian: Brivan Eliath Quenox Frador

## Runbook: Digest scheduling — Pelicanpost

Reviewer notes: the batch email digest job on Pelicanpost fires from the `digestd` worker pool, keyed by subscriber timezone buckets. Each bucket flushes once per window; missed windows roll forward, never backward. Check that the PR does not alter bucket width without bumping the schema version, and that jitter stays within the documented bounds — last quarter's Tarnbridge outage came from a silent jitter change. Before approving, diff the PR against the reference settings below.

config for kagup-hahig:
druwyn:
  pin: 2801
  metrics_host: metrics.druwyn.zemvarlabs.internal
  tenant: sorius
  seal: seal_798a43d7

For department heads. Operating cash flow forecast at 4.2M, down 9% on prior quarter due to slower Renwick collections and one-off tooling spend at the Calverton site. Receivables ageing has worsened; finance is tightening terms for new Orbane contracts. Capex holds at plan. Discretionary spend freezes above 10K without CFO approval through quarter-end. Headroom on the credit facility remains adequate. Submit revised departmental forecasts within five business days. The assumptions behind this outlook are stated below.

internal memo for yawip-kajef: Silirox Partners plans to raise the Kelox list price by 30 percent in December.

Investigation shows the staging cluster drifted from the declared baseline after a manual hotfix in March was never backported to the manifest repository. This affects any plugin relying on documented suppression-list timing, so please treat the published defaults as unreliable until this ticket closes. To help plugin authors verify their assumptions, the currently deployed production configuration is captured below.

settings of tagef-bawif:
DRUIX_HOST=druix.zemvarlabs.internal
DRUIX_PORT=8000